Power study, it also … WebMar 14, 2024 · High-risk life insurance, as the term indicates, is a class of life insurance which is meant for people with a high mortality risk. It is also referred to as impaired risk life insurance. The most important factor which determines the cost of your life insurance coverage is your mortality risk. Insurance companies use a wide range of health and ...

WebAug 23, 2024 · If you work in a high-risk job, such as construction or the military, your life insurance will likely cost more. The same is true if you enjoy high-risk activities like rock climbing or skydiving. Lifestyle. Insurers will consider your personal habits, such as tobacco use, driving record, criminal history and more.
